GENERAL INSTRUCTIONS

Prior to plugging your appliance into an electrical outlet, verify that the house circuit breakers for the
outlet are on.
The appliance may emit a slight, harmless odour when fi rst used. This odour is normal and it is
caused by the initial heating of internal appliance elements and will not occur again.
If your appliance does not emit heat, consult the "OPERATION" section of this manual for further
information.
Use with a CSA or UL certifi ed surge protector.
Do not route the power cord directly underneath the appliance.
This electric appliance meets the construction and safety standards of H.U.D. for application in
manufactured homes when installed according to these instructions.
As with most electronic devices, your new electric fi replace has been designed to operate at
temperatures between 5°C (41°F) and 35° C (95°F). During the colder winter months, allow the fi replace
to reach room temperature before turning it on.

UNPACKING AND TESTING APPLIANCE

Carefully remove the appliance from the box. Prior to installing the appliance, remove all packaging
material and test to make sure the appliance operates properly by plugging the power supply cord into a
conveniently located 120V, 15 Amp minimum grounded outlet.
NOTE: The appliance is factory wired for 120 volt power supply. If 240 volt operation is required, see
"240V HARD WIRING INSTALLATION" section.
